What companies run services between Temple Bar, Ireland and EPIC The Irish Emigration Museum, Ireland?

Luas operates a vehicle from Jervis to George's Dock every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 6 min. Alternatively, Dublin Bus operates a bus from Ormond Quay Upr to S O'Casey Br every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 7 min.
